Springs Charter Schools values parent choice. We know a one-size-fits-all approach to education doesn’t work. That’s why we’ve created a diverse set of program offerings. Many of our parents choose to Homeschool full-time while others choose two to five days of a blended model which combines classroom instruction with home study.
